All Posts Tagged Tag: ‘Google Street’

Did Google Street View Catch A Break Up Scene?

Ever since Google has introduced the “Street View” function to its Maps service, there have been all kinds of discoveries and finds by users all over the globe. So much so, in fact, a multitude of publications–this one included–have leveraged these finds for content. A great example of this is the StreetViewFun blog, which, as the name implies, catalogs some …

Read More